概括
这项研究介绍了NiCTRAM,这是一种用于可见红外人重新识别的新方法. 通过有效地融合不同成像模式的特征,NiCTRAM在具有挑战性的条件下提高了准确性.

主要方法:
- 拟议的NiCTRAM:一个基于Nyström变压器的交叉模式变压器.
- 利用共享的CNN骨干从RGB和IR图像中进行分层的特征提取.
- 采用并行Nyströmformer编码器,以有效地捕获远程依赖.
- 引入了交叉注意力融合块,集成了二次共变率统计数据以实现特征对齐.
主要成果:
- 在基准VIS-IR人重识别数据集上,NiCTRAM实现了最先进的性能.
- 与现有方法相比,显示出显著的改进,在排名-1准确度上超过SOTA高达5.90%,在mAP中超过5.83%.
- 在处理VIS-IR Re-ID.中固有的跨模式挑战方面表现出强大的稳定性.

In IR spectroscopy, signals produced by the X−H bonds (such as C−H, O−H, or N−H) can be observed in the frequency range of 2700–4000 cm–1. The C−H stretching vibration forms sharp bands in the region 2850–3000 cm–1. The presence of the O−H stretching vibration leads to the forming of an absorption band in the frequency range 3650–3200 cm−1.
